在现代计算机操作系统中,命令提示符(cmd)仍然是一个强大的工具,尤其在Windows系统中,它是执行系统级命令和脚本的首选界面。然而,有时候你可能需要查看某个命令执行的过程,以便分析其执行细节或者解决执行中遇到的问题。以下是一招轻松的方法,帮助你查看cmd执行日志,追踪命令执行的全过程。
什么是cmd执行日志?
cmd执行日志是指记录了命令提示符中输入的命令以及命令执行结果的文件。通过查看这些日志,你可以了解命令是如何被执行的,以及执行过程中发生了什么。
如何查看cmd执行日志?
在Windows系统中,你可以通过以下步骤查看cmd执行日志:
打开cmd界面:按下
Win + R键,输入cmd并按回车,或者直接在开始菜单中搜索并打开命令提示符。使用
start命令:在cmd中,你可以使用start命令来执行另一个程序或命令,同时将执行过程输出到日志文件中。例如:
start log.txt "echo 开始执行命令" && echo 命令1 && echo 命令2
这条命令将会执行一系列命令,并将输出结果保存到log.txt文件中。
查看日志文件:执行完毕后,你可以在相同目录下找到
log.txt文件,用记事本或其他文本编辑器打开,查看执行过程。使用
>和>>重定向符:如果你想直接在命令行中查看输出,可以使用>(覆盖写入)和>>(追加写入)重定向符将输出重定向到控制台或文件。例如:
echo 开始执行命令 > output.log
echo 命令1 >> output.log
echo 命令2 >> output.log
这样,所有的输出都会被追加到output.log文件中。
高级技巧
使用
echo off关闭命令回显:如果你不希望命令本身也出现在日志文件中,可以在脚本或命令序列前加上echo off命令。使用
set命令设置环境变量:你可以使用set命令来设置环境变量,并在日志文件中记录这些变量,以便追踪命令执行过程中的环境配置。使用
time命令记录执行时间:time命令可以用来测量代码块的执行时间,这对于性能分析和日志记录非常有用。
通过上述方法,你不仅可以轻松查看cmd执行日志,还可以对命令执行过程进行更深入的分析。掌握这些技巧,将使你在使用cmd时更加得心应手。
